Overall sentiment in the reviews is positive: residents and visitors consistently describe Linwood Community as a clean, comfortable, and well-kept place that would be suitable for an older adult. Cleanliness and general comfort are emphasized repeatedly, and the facility’s upkeep appears reliable. Several comments highlight that it "looks like a nice place to stay for elder person," which underscores an overall impression of appropriateness and safety for seniors.
Facilities and outdoor spaces are a clear strength. Multiple reviewers call out good-sized balconies and a pleasant outdoor environment with plants and an outdoor grill. These features suggest residents have access to private outdoor space and shared outdoor amenities that can support relaxation and light social interaction. The balconies are described as a noteworthy positive ("good size balconies"), which contributes to residents' comfort and satisfaction.
Staffing and the care environment are portrayed favorably. The phrase "nice, friendly, caring environment" appears in the reviews, indicating residents or visitors perceive staff and the social atmosphere as warm and compassionate. That consistent mention of friendliness and caring implies a supportive day-to-day experience for residents, even though the reviews do not provide granular detail about specific caregiving tasks or clinical services.
Dining and kitchen receive modest, mixed commentary. The kitchen is described as "acceptable," which suggests it meets basic needs but is not a standout feature. One review frames the kitchen as adequate rather than exceptional; this is not presented as a major complaint, but it is a potential area where expectations vary and where improvements could raise overall satisfaction.
The most notable concern across the reviews is that the facility "needs updating." While reviewers also call the building "well kept up," the call for updating points to aging finishes, décor, or systems that may be mechanically sound but visually or functionally dated. This creates a pattern: good maintenance keeps the place tidy and functional, yet some areas may benefit from modernization to better match contemporary expectations for senior living environments.
There are also informational gaps in the reviews. Reviewers do not provide detailed feedback on specific programs, activity levels, medical/nursing care quality, or management responsiveness. Because the comments focus primarily on cleanliness, comfort, outdoor spaces, and staff demeanor, prospective residents should seek additional information or a tour to assess programming, clinical services, meal quality in detail, and the scope/timing of any planned updates.
In summary, Linwood Community is portrayed as a clean, comfortable, and quiet senior living option with pleasant outdoor amenities and a warm, caring atmosphere. It appears well maintained and appropriate for older adults, though some aesthetic or modernization updates may be desired. The kitchen meets basic expectations but is not highlighted as exceptional. Prospective residents and families will likely appreciate the cleanliness, private balconies, and friendly staff, but should follow up on specifics about dining, activities, clinical services, and any planned renovations to ensure the community matches their full set of priorities.
